Job description

Olson Kundig is a design practice founded on the ideas that buildings can serve as abridge between nature, culture, and people, and that inspiring surroundings have a positive effect on people’s lives. The firm’s work can be found across the globe, with projects as wide-ranging as huts to high rises, homes - often for art collectors - to academic, cultural, and civic projects, museums and exhibition design, places of worship, creative production, urban design, and interior design.


We are seeking an Interior Designer III tocontribute design, technical, and coordination expertise across all phases of interior design work, with a primary focus on commercial interiors and the ability to support select residential projects. Working closely with project leadership, this role helps develop thoughtful, well-resolved interior environments from programming and concept design through documentation, specifications, and construction administration.


You’ll join a team where curiosity, attention to detail, and a strong sense of urgency help shape thoughtful work and support your growth as a designer.


Primary Responsibilities

Design & Documentation


  • Develops interior design concepts, space plans, test fits, material palettes, finish strategies, and graphically strong presentation materials that translate client goals into clear design direction.

  • Prepares interior design documentation, including plans, elevations, finish plans and schedules, interior details, material palettes, FFE, art, and specifications.

  • Applies knowledge of interior systems, finish materials, furniture, fixtures, equipment, and product solutions appropriate to interior environments.

  • Reviews, compiles, and prepares project specifications in coordination with project leadership.


Project Coordination & Management


  • Supports the planning, programming, design, documentation, and coordination of primarily commercial interiors projects.

  • Coordinates with Partners, Directors, Principals, project managers, consultants, vendors, fabricators, contractors, and reps to support design intent, technical resolution, budgeting, procurement coordination, and project delivery.

  • Supports and may lead portions of construction administration, including submittal review, RFI coordination, finish sample review, and site observation related to interior design scope.


Communication & Collaboration


  • Communicates design and technical viewpoints clearly in team, consultant, vendor, and client-facing settings.

  • Prepares and contributes to presentations, design narratives, meeting materials, and external project communications.

  • Contributes ideas, solutions, and deliverables in collaborative project environments.


Growth, Leadership, & Mentorship


  • Guides and reviews work by less experienced interior design team members.

  • Contributes to process improvement, knowledge sharing, and the ongoing development of interior design materials, tools, standards, and workflows.

  • Performs other duties as assigned.


Qualifications

Must Have


  • Education: a professional degree in interior design, interior architecture, architecture, or related design discipline.

  • Experience: 5-9 yearsof related professional design experience, preferably within an architecture, interior design, or integrated design practice.
    Working knowledge of interior construction, millwork detailing, finish schedules, furniture systems, materials, and specifications.

  • Digital Literacy: Proficient modeling and documentation skills using Autodesk Revit.

  • Portfolio: Submit a portfolio thatdemonstratesinterior design, technical documentation, materiality, and presentation skills.

  • Communication: Strong verbal and written communication skills with the ability to collaborate effectively with internal teams, clients, and vendors.

  • Work Style: High attention to detail, strong prioritization skills, and the ability to work in a fast-paced, creative, and dynamic environment


Nice to Have


  • Demonstrated experience on commercial interiors projects; experience with workplace, hospitality, retail, cultural, or mixed-use project types is preferred.

  • Residential interiors experience, or a demonstrated residential sensibility around materiality, detailing, furniture, and client service, is a plus.
